Antonio B. Won Pat International Airport

   

Antonio B. Won Pat International Airport is an airport in Tamuning, Guam. It has the IATA Airport Code GUM, and it is a hub to Continental Micronesia. The airport is six miles northeast of Hagåtña, Guam.

Tragedy came in 1997 when Korean Air Flight 801 crashed before it could land at GUM. Only 26 passengers survived.
